Requisition Id16025 Overview: The Advanced Engineering Technologies (AET) Group is seeking a dedicated individual to support our organization. The position will involve machine design and process engineering in a research and development atmosphere. Projects range from new equipment detailed design and tooling, to small consulting tasks. AET resides within the Nuclear Nonproliferation Division (NND) at Oak Ridge National Lab (ORNL). The NND is a division operating within the National Security Sciences Directorate at ORNL. NND staff contributes world class research, technology development, risk assessment, and systems analysis related to nonproliferation and counterproliferation. The division activities play a vital role in implementation of national policy issues that strive to ensure global nuclear security. One of the major focus areas of the AET group is the development of advanced approaches to operation, characterization, and analysis of nuclear fuel cycle processes. The group specializes in the application of engineering principles supporting the characterization of processes and related materials. The AET group collaborates and works with staff from other groups within NND and ORNL to assure the full expertise of fuel cycle processes are applied to meet sponsor needs.
